vic20

There are 90 repositories under vic20 topic.

  • TomHarte/CLK

    A latency-hating emulator of: the Acorn Electron and Archimedes, Amstrad CPC, Apple II/II+/IIe and early Macintosh, Atari 2600 and ST, ColecoVision, Enterprise 64/128, Commodore Vic-20 and Amiga, MSX 1/2, Oric 1/Atmos, early PC compatibles, Sega Master System, Sinclair ZX80/81 and ZX Spectrum.

    Language:C++9463427052
  • frntc/Sidekick64

    Sidekick64: A Versatile Software-Defined Cartridge for the C64, C128, C16, plus/4, and VIC20

    Language:C++28636033
  • GeorgRottensteiner/C64Studio

    C64Studio is a .NET based IDE specializing in game development for the C64 in assembler and BASIC

    Language:C#259279938
  • mcicolella/awesome-emulators-simulators

    A curated list of software emulators and simulators of PCs, home computers, mainframes, consoles, robots and much more...

  • EgonOlsen71/basicv2

    A Commodore (CBM) BASIC V2 interpreter/compiler written in Java

    Language:Java86135115
  • svenpetersen1965/C64-A-V-Adaptor

    An A/V-adaptor board for the C64

  • danwerner21/vic2020

    A Vic-20 clone created with [almost] all readily available parts

    Language:OpenSCAD596811
  • informedcitizenry/6502.Net

    A .Net-based Cross-Assembler for Several 8-Bit Microprocessors

    Language:C#5881617
  • cbmtapepi

    RhinoDevel/cbmtapepi

    Use a Raspberry Pi as fast mass storage solution for your Commodore 8-bit computer using just the datassette port.

    Language:C55778
  • EgonOlsen71/petsciiator

    A converter tool to convert JPG/PNG images into Commodore PETSCII (and Multicolor / Koala-Painter)

    Language:Java45453
  • Dennis1000/mos6502-delphi

    A MOS 6502 CPU emulator written in Delphi (a very basic C64 + VIC20 emulator included)

    Language:Pascal3413216
  • hotkeysoft/emulators

    Emulators for 8080/8085, 8086/8088, Z80, 6502 and TMS1000-family CPUs

    Language:C++33300
  • calmopyrin/yapesdl

    Multiplatform 8-bit Commodore home computer family emulator written in C++ using SDL2.

    Language:C31867
  • morphx666/x8086NetEmu

    A VB.NET implementation of an almost working 8086 emulator.

    Language:Visual Basic .NET305123
  • pietrop/electron-video-downloader

    A minimal Electron application to download videos, eg from youtube, and associated captions (optional). Uses youtube-dl under the hood.

    Language:JavaScript24354
  • theflyingape/vic-sss

    Commodore VIC20: Software Sprite Stack library using modern 6502 assembler

    Language:Assembly24405
  • davervw/simple-emu-c64

    Terminal 6502 Emulator with Commodore 64, 128, Vic-20, PET 2001, and TED: C16, Plus/4

    Language:C#15523
  • jfoucher/picovic

    Vic-20 emulation on a Raspberry Pi Pico

    Language:C15371
  • ops/FE3-Firmware

    Firmware for VIC-20 Final Expansion 3

    Language:Assembly12724
  • Commnets/EMULATORS

    A C++ framework to create classic computer emulators. Commodore 64, VIC20, C264 series and ZX81 implementations already provided

    Language:C++10200
  • theflyingape/berzerk-mmx

    Commodore VIC20: a popular retroarcade clone using modern 6502 assembler

    Language:Assembly9400
  • catseye/hatoucan

    MIRROR of https://codeberg.org/catseye/hatoucan : A tokenizer for Commodore BASIC 2.0 programs

    Language:Python8301
  • davervw/hires-vic-20

    High Resolution Commodore 2.0 BASIC extensions for Vic-20

    Language:Assembly8202
  • vossstef/VIC20Nano

    Commodore VIC20 core for the Tang Nano 20k Primer 20k Primer 25k Nano 9k Mega138k Pro FPGA

    Language:VHDL8361
  • mobluse/chargen-maker

    Make a chargen file (character generator ROM) from an 8x8 text file with 512 characters

    Language:BASIC7301
  • tomzox/vic20_games

    This is a collection of games I wrote in the early 80s in machine language for the VIC-20.

    Language:Assembly7200
  • christo/revenge

    Reverse Engineering Environment for Retro-Programming

    Language:TypeScript6221
  • ops/vic-cc65-cart

    Simple stub for VIC-20 cart image created with cc65 compiler suite

    Language:Assembly6101
  • stefanschramm/retroload

    RetroLoad.com is a web application for converting tape archive files of historical computers into sound.

    Language:TypeScript63160
  • theflyingape/omega-fury

    Commodore VIC20: Omega Race sequel using modern 6502 assembler

    Language:Assembly6401
  • vossstef/tang_nano_9k_vic20_hdmi

    Commodore VIC-20 core for the Tang Nano 9k FPGA

    Language:VHDL6130
  • breqdev/noentiendo

    A modular retro emulation framework, supporting the Commodore PET, VIC-20, and others across desktop and WASM platforms!

    Language:Rust5300
  • ops/FE3-Software-Collection

    Collection of VIC-20 software with loader files for FE3

  • ops/ulticonfig

    Simple UI for UltiMem configuration

    Language:Assembly5100
  • ops/ultimem

    UltiMem tools

    Language:Assembly5100
  • DylanPollock/Monkey_Head_Project

    The Monkey Head Project ("Huey") is a universal AI/OS, "GenCore", designed to seamlessly integrate into a diverse range of hardware and software systems. It embodies a modular framework with the "Federation" Governance System, ensuring adaptability and interoperability across various technological environments. [*Developed by DLRP*]

    Language:Python4202